Program Curriculum

Module 1

Introduction to Livestock Agriculture and Market Analysis

1.1 Introduction to Livestock Agriculture

  1. Overview of livestock species and their significance in agriculture.
  2. Breeds, genetics, and breeding management.
  3. Livestock health and disease management.

1.2 Market Analysis and Trends

  1. Identifying market trends and opportunities in the livestock sector.
  2. Market research techniques and data analysis.
  3. Case studies on successful livestock businesses.

Module 2

Cattle Production and Value Chain

2.1 Pre-Productions Activities to Cattle

  1. Selecting and sourcing cattle breeds.
  2. Planning and designing cattle housing and infrastructure.
  3. Feed and nutrition management for cattle.

2.2 Cattle Production and Management

  1. Reproduction and breeding management.
  2. Health and disease management.
  3. Growth and performance optimization.

Module 3

Cattle Processing, Packaging and Value Chain

3.1 Cattle Processing and Value Addition

  1. Slaughtering and meat processing techniques.
  2. Dairy product processing.
  3. Ensuring product quality and safety.

3.2 Packaging and Distribution

  1. Packaging and labeling for cattle products.
  2. Distribution and logistics management.
  3. Compliance with regulatory standards.

Module 4

Small Ruminant(Goat and Sheep) Production and Value Chain

4.1 Pre-Production Activities for Small Ruminant

  1. Selecting and sourcing small ruminant breeds.
  2. Planning and designing housing and grazing systems.
  3. Nutrition and forage management.

4.2 Small Ruminant , Prodcution and Management

  1. Breeding and reproduction management.
  2. Health and disease control.
  3. Optimization of growth and production.

Module 5

Small Ruminant Processing, Packaging and Value Chain

5.1 Small Ruminant Processing and Value Chain

  1. Meat processing for goat and sheep.
  2. Ensuring quality and safety standards.

5.2 Packaging and Distribution

  1. Packaging techniques for small ruminant products.
  2. Establishing distribution networks.
  3. Meeting regulatory packaging and labeling requirements.

Module 6

Pig Production and Value Chain

6.1 Pre-Production Activities for Pigs

  1. Selecting and sourcing pig breeds.
  2. Housing and environmental management.
  3. Nutrition and feed management for pigs.

6.2 Pig Production and Management

  1. Breeding and reproduction management.
  2. Health and disease control.
  3. Strategies for efficient growth and production.

Module 7

Pig Processing, Packaging and Value Chain

7.1 Pig Processing and Value addition

  1. Slaughtering and pork processing.
  2. Pig by-products utilization (e.g., lard).
  3. Quality assurance and safety protocols.

7.2 Packaging and Distribution

  1. Effective packaging methods for pork products
  2. Distribution strategies and cold chain management
  3. Compliance with packaging and labeling regulations.

Module 8

Rabbit and Snail Farming and Value Chain

8.1 Pre-Production Activities for Rabbits and Snails

  1. Selecting and sourcing rabbit and snail breeds.
  2. Habitat design and maintenance
  3. Feeding and nutrition management for rabbits and snails.

8.2 Rabbit ad Snail Production and Management

  1. Reproduction and breeding management
  2. Health and disease control
  3. Strategies for efficient growth and production.

Module 9

Rabbit and Snail Processing, Packaging and Value Chain

9.1 Rabbit and Snail Processing and Value Addition

  1. Processing techniques for rabbit meat and snail products
  2. Quality and safety standards
  3. Innovation in value addition.

9.2 Packaging and Distribution

  1. Packaging and labeling for rabbit and snail products.
  2. Developing distribution channels
  3. Compliance with regulatory packaging and labeling requirement.

Module 10

Financial Management and Operations 

10.1 Financial Management and Livestock Farming

  1. Budgeting and financial planning for livestock enterprises
  2. Investment analysis and risk management
  3. Financial record-keeping and analysis.

10.2 Operations Management

  1. Farm layout and infrastructure planning
  2. Supply chain management for livestock products.
  3. Sustainability and resource management
